Why These Are the Top Jeep Repair Auto Repair Shops in Terra Ceia

** The Jeep service market for Terra Ceia residents is characterized by high-quality regional options rather than local in-town shops. The competition level is moderate but specialized; while there are many general mechanics, only a handful of shops possess the specific expertise, equipment, and reputation for serious Jeep repair and modification. * **Average Quality:** The top-tier shops are excellent, with technicians who are enthusiasts themselves and stay current with the complexities of modern Jeeps. The overall market average is pulled down by general repair shops that may lack specialized 4x4 diagnostic tools. * **Competition Level:** Moderate competition among the 3-4 specialized shops in the greater Bradenton/Palmetto area. This benefits the consumer, as these shops compete on quality of work and customer service. * **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is competitive with the broader Tampa Bay region. Basic maintenance is reasonably priced, while specialized work commands a premium. Expect to pay: * $100-$150/hr for labor. * $1,500 - $4,000+ for a quality suspension lift kit installation (parts and labor). * $400 - $800 for a differential service. * Premium pricing for complex engine (especially EcoDiesel) or electronic diagnostics. Consumers are advised to book appointments well in advance, especially with the top specialists, as their reputation often leads to wait times of several weeks.

What are the most common Jeep repair issues for drivers in the Terra Ceia area?

Given our coastal environment, Terra Ceia Jeep owners frequently deal with rust and corrosion on frames and undercarriages from salt air. Soft top wear and sun damage to interiors are also common due to the intense Florida sun. Additionally, 4x4 systems and suspension components on lifted Jeeps often need servicing from use on local sandy trails and beach access roads.

Are Jeep repairs more expensive in Terra Ceia compared to other areas?

Labor rates in the Terra Ceia/Bradenton area are generally competitive, but parts costs for genuine Mopar components are consistent nationwide. Specialized off-road modifications or repairs can increase costs. It's wise to get a detailed written estimate that accounts for potential corrosion-related complications, which can add labor time for our coastal vehicles.

When should I seek immediate service for my Jeep in Terra Ceia's climate?

Seek immediate service for any warning lights related to the engine, transmission, or 4WD system, especially before tackling sandy or flooded areas common after our summer rains. Also, address any unusual steering wobble or brake issues promptly, as these are critical for safe driving on our mix of rural roads and busy coastal highways like US-41.

What local considerations should I discuss with a Terra Ceia Jeep repair shop?

Always mention if your Jeep is frequently driven on the beach or through saltwater, as this requires more aggressive undercarriage maintenance and inspections. Discuss your typical driving, whether it's commuting over the Skyway Bridge or off-roading at nearby preserves, as this affects service priorities. Ensure the shop understands the drainage needs for Jeeps that may have taken on water in our frequent heavy rains.
